Garrett: Race to the Top gaffe is a teachable moment

By Rep. Scott Garrett
August 29, 2010

On Tuesday, the U.S. Department of Education announced the 10 finalists for the “Race to the Top” initiative. Enacted shortly after President Obama took office, this program allows states to apply for federal education funding after they implement educational reforms in line with the goals of the Obama Administration.

As most are aware of by now, New Jersey was not a recipient of the funding.

While my congressional colleagues and I will do what we can to ensure that New Jersey’s application was — and will continue to be — treated fairly, it’s my hope that no matter what happens, we can take a step back and use this experience as a teachable moment.

After all, it is illustrative of a broader problem we face: Greater and greater control of our educational system is being wrested from our local school boards and placed into the hands of faceless bureaucrats in Washington, D.C.
